Understanding Indoor Air Top quality (IAQ)
What is Indoor Air Quality?
Indoor Air Quality (IAQ) describes the condition of the air within buildings, particularly as it associates with the health and wellness and convenience of passengers. Poor IAQ can bring about a wide variety of health and wellness issues varying from headaches and tiredness to serious breathing problems.
Why is IAQ Important?
Good IAQ is essential for keeping total well-being. It influences our mood, efficiency, and even our physical wellness. Lots of people invest nearly 90% of their time inside; hence, ensuring clean air ought to be a priority.

Ventilation: The Breath of Fresh Air
Importance of Correct Ventilation
Proper air flow helps flow fresh outside air while removing stagnant indoor air loaded with pollutants.
Tips for Improving Ventilation
- Open home windows when climate permits. Use exhaust followers in kitchens and bathrooms. Consider installing a power healing ventilator (ERV).
Dehumidifiers: Keeping Humidity at Bay
What Are Dehumidifiers?
Dehumidifiers remove dampness from the air, which helps prevent mold and mildew growth and reduces Visit this website allergens.
Choosing the Right Dehumidifier
When picking a dehumidifier:
- Assess room size Check water container capacity Look for functions like auto-shutoff
